Psalms 2

NEW AMERICAN BIBLEKING JAMES BIBLE
1 Why do the nations protest and the peoples grumble in vain?1 Why do the heathen rage, and the people imagine a vain thing?
2 Kings on earth rise up and princes plot together against the LORD and his anointed:2 The kings of the earth set themselves, and the rulers take counsel together, against the LORD, and against his anointed, saying,
3 "Let us break their shackles and cast off their chains!"3 Let us break their bands asunder, and cast away their cords from us.
4 The one enthroned in heaven laughs; the Lord derides them,4 He that sitteth in the heavens shall laugh: the Lord shall have them in derision.
5 Then speaks to them in anger, terrifies them in wrath:5 Then shall he speak unto them in his wrath, and vex them in his sore displeasure.
6 "I myself have installed my king on Zion, my holy mountain."6 Yet have I set my king upon my holy hill of Zion.
7 I will proclaim the decree of the LORD, who said to me, "You are my son; today I am your father.7 I will declare the decree: the LORD hath said unto me, Thou art my Son; this day have I begotten thee.
8 Only ask it of me, and I will make your inheritance the nations, your possession the ends of the earth.8 Ask of me, and I shall give thee the heathen for thine inheritance, and the uttermost parts of the earth for thy possession.
9 With an iron rod you shall shepherd them, like a clay pot you will shatter them."9 Thou shalt break them with a rod of iron; thou shalt dash them in pieces like a potter's vessel.
10 And now, kings, give heed; take warning, rulers on earth.10 Be wise now therefore, O ye kings: be instructed, ye judges of the earth.
11 Serve the LORD with fear; with trembling bow down in homage, Lest God be angry and you perish from the way in a sudden blaze of anger. Happy are all who take refuge in God!11 Serve the LORD with fear, and rejoice with trembling.
12 Kiss the Son, lest he be angry, and ye perish from the way, when his wrath is kindled but a little. Blessed are all they that put their trust in him.
